Ticket: SQUAT-412. The Parcelwatch typo-squatting scanner stopped ingesting registry diffs on Monday. Root cause: the credential for the internal mirror service expired after the 90-day rotation policy kicked in, and nobody updated the cron job's secret. Scans have been silently no-oping since; backfill will be needed for the gap. A replacement credential was issued today and should be placed in the scanner's env file. New key for the mirror service follows.

service key, fawip-bajef: kto11_Qt5wZK9vdNC

Quick runbook note on the Emberline firmware channel. Devices poll the channel every six hours; pushing a new build means bumping the manifest version, signing it, and letting the rollout ring logic do its thing — don't force-push to the stable ring unless Ops signs off. If a rollout stalls, check the ring gate first, not the signer; nine times out of ten a gate got stuck at 10%. The channel service starts with these values.

settings of tagef-bawif:
DRUIX_HOST=druix.zemvarlabs.internal
DRUIX_PORT=8000

Ticket PAY-2141: Signature check failed on retry batch

New folks: the Tollgate gateway rejects replayed payment retries unless the idempotency key matches the original request's signed envelope. Last night's retry job regenerated keys, so signatures no longer validated and the batch bounced. Fix is to reuse stored keys from the Retryvault table. To re-sign the corrected batch, use the deploy key below.

deploy key for yagap-kawig: bky4_Q8dK

Welcome to the Pagerloom rotation. Before your first shift, familiarize yourself with Dedupe Hollow, our alert deduplicator. It collapses duplicate pages from Signalbranch into a single incident, keyed on service name and fingerprint hash. If Dedupe Hollow is degraded, alerts will fan out raw, so verify its health check at the start of every shift. You will need to authenticate against the Hollow admin API to inspect suppression rules or flush a stuck fingerprint. Use the key below for that purpose.

gateway credential: kto23_LX9A4ys6i4nzHtpOLNLodKK